2023/24 AdmiralBet ABA League Round 9, Saturday, 25 November 2023:

BUDUĆNOST VOLI – CEDEVITA OLIMPIJA 

Where? Morača Sports Hall, Podgorica

When? 19:00

Story of the game: In the opening game of the AdmiralBet ABA League Round 9, Budućnost VOLI will be hosting Cedevita Olimpija at home in their Morača Sports Hall in Podgorica.

It’s a game of two squds with the highest possible ambitions in the AdmiralBet ABA League and two, that are currently just one step below the very top of the standings, with 6:2 records after 8 games played so far this season.

And while Budućnost VOLI are entering this game following the Round 8 defeat in Laktaši, and have replaced their head coach with the new tactician Andrej Žakelj, Cedevita Olimpija have prevailed in their last 4 games in the AdmiralBet ABA League and are currently full of self-confidence.

History, however, reveals that Morača Sports Hall has always been a tough away court for the Dragons of Ljubljana, as Budućnost VOLI have won in all 4 games between the two squads in Podgorica played so far.

Will the tradition continue, or will Cedevita Olimpija continue their amazing winning streak?

Match-up in focus: Perhaps the most interesting match-up of the game will be the one between McKinley Wright of Budućnost VOLI and Klemen Prepelič of Cedevita Olimpija. While Wright is currently the top scorer and second-leading passer of Budućnost VOLI, averaging 14.6 points and 3.7 assists per game, Prepelič has been averaging 17.5 points and 11 assists per game so far this season in the AdmiralBet ABA League as Cedevita Olimpija’s top scorer and top passer. Who will lead his team to the win this time?

Head-to-head score in the regional league: In total 6:2, In Podgorica 4:0.
